  11. Okay i live in the neighboorhood and am a vegitarian so take my word on this.

     

    DO NOT GO TO THE CHICAGO DINER, over priced and not very good its mostly just fake meats anyway.

     

    INDIAN FOOD

    I recomend Star of India, its right across the street from the vic(oppiste side of the street across belmont) you can get an excellent indian buffet for 8 bucks.

     

     

    DINNER FOOD WITH MANY VEGGIE OPTIONS

    Also if your gonna go to a diner skip out on Clarks and check out PICK ME UP, they have several veggie options (tofu scrambles, veggie burger, hummus sandwich, veggie chili and some more stuff). this place is a block north of the vic on sheffield (expect to pay between 8-10 for a meal)

     

    THAI/Asian

     

    I recomend COZY or Pennys both are close to the vic. Cozy is across the street from pick up me so its a little over a 2 blocks. Pennys is also on sheffield near pick me up. If you go to cozy get the Cashew and ask them to make it with tofu veggie style (if you dont metion veggie style they will use fish sauce) they also have very good veggie rolls and red curry with cocunut milk. You can get a great entree for about 7 bucks there and its a really cool atmosphere, nothing like any thai resturant youve been to.
